The coastal proximity keeps temperatures mild, but that doesn't mean your garage door gets a break. Salt air drifts inland, causing subtle corrosion on springs and hardware that catches homeowners off guard. Springs typically last 7 to 9 years here, not the 10 you might expect inland. Metal rollers wear faster than nylon ones in this environment.

We see specific patterns in Irvine service calls. Opener sensors misalign frequently because of foundation settling in newer developments. Weatherstripping dries out quickly in the sun. Our Irvine garage door technicians handle the full range of residential services. Spring replacement tops our call list because broken springs are both dangerous and common. We stock high-cycle torsion springs that outlast builder-grade options, and we replace both springs even if only one breaks (the second one is right behind it).

Opener installation comes next.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ie models, and we'll walk you through which features matter for your situation. Battery backup makes sense in Irvine despite reliable power. Smart openers with phone control have become standard in newer Woodbridge and Northwood homes, and retrofitting one to your existing system takes about two hours.

Cable and roller repair often gets ignored until the door sounds like a freight train. Worn rollers create that grinding noise. Frayed cables are a safety issue. We replace both as preventive maintenance, not just after failure. Full door replacement becomes necessary when panels crack, the door no longer insulates properly, or you're ready for an upgrade that matches your home's updated exterior.

Maintenance plans keep everything running smoothly between emergencies. Annual service includes lubricating moving parts, testing safety features, adjusting spring tension, and catching small problems before they strand your car inside. Request a maintenance quote for any Irvine ZIP code.

What's the most common garage door problem in Irvine?

Broken torsion springs lead our service calls by a wide margin. The coastal air accelerates spring fatigue, and most builder-installed springs weren't rated for the cycle count your family actually uses. Opener sensor issues come second, usually from bumped alignment or spiderwebs blocking the beam.

How much does spring replacement cost in Irvine?

Standard two-car garage spring replacement typically runs $225 to $295 depending on door weight and spring quality. We recommend high-cycle springs that add about $40 but last significantly longer.
